DRB1 antibody (N-Term)

This anti-DRB1 antibody is a Rabbit Polyclonal antibody detecting DRB1 in WB. Suitable for Dog, Human, Mouse and Rat.

  • Format

    Lyophilized

    Reconstitution

    Lyophilized powder. Add distilled water for a 1 mg/mL concentration of DRB1 antibody in PBS

    Concentration

    Lot specific

    Buffer

    PBS

    Handling Advice

    Avoid repeated freeze/thaw cycles.
    Dilute only prior to immediate use.

    Storage

    4 °C/-20 °C

    Storage Comment

    Store at 2-8 °C for short periods. For longer periods of storage, store at -20 °C.
  • Target

    DRB1 (Dopamine Receptor Binding 1 (DRB1))

    Alternative Name

    DRB1

    Background

    DRB1 is RNA-binding protein with binding specificity for poly(C) and may play an important role in neural development.

    Molecular Weight

    36 kDa (MW of target protein)
